IDBI will open 10 new branches in Orissa by end of 2009-10

By the end of 2009-10 fiscal year the Industrial Development Bank of India (IDBI) plans to open 10 new branches in Orissa this was informed by Arun Kumar Panda, Deputy General Manager of the bank during the inauguration of the 11th branch of IDBI Bank at Talcher.

He said the new branches to be opened will be over and above the existing 11 branches of IDBI in the state.

The branch was inaugurated by PR Das, Chairman of the Orissa State Financial Corporation (OSFC). Panda said, “The IDBI may also set up a branch at Angul soon”. He told out of the 10 branches proposed to be set up, four of then will be opened by the end of this month while the other six branches will be opened later.
